China's colorist community has grown alongside the country's box-office surge. Most of the core talent trained through Beijing Film Academy's cinematography track and the colour pipelines at Base FX Beijing, More VFX, Beijing Film Group Post, Shanghai Film Studio Post, Pixomondo Beijing, and iQIYI Post Production. Reference points range widely. At one end sit the saturated wuxia palettes Christopher Doyle and Zhao Xiaoding set on Wong Kar-wai's In the Mood for Love and Zhang Yimou's Hero and Curse of the Golden Flower. At the other sit the calm naturalism of Jia Zhangke's Still Life and Mountains May Depart, finished by Matthieu Laclau, and the bleach-bypass grades on Diao Yinan's Black Coal Thin Ice that won Berlin's Golden Bear. Then there are the high-saturation digital looks that Frant Gwo's Wandering Earth and Wuershan's Creation of the Gods Trilogy have made house style for Chinese tentpoles.
Our colorists work mostly in DaVinci Resolve, with Baselight ready at the larger Beijing and Shanghai houses. They confidently deliver HDR10, Dolby Vision, and SDR theatrical masters. These serve Chinese theatrical release through China Film Group's distribution pipeline as well as global rollouts that need parallel SARFT-compliant masters and Western-market deliverables.
Day to day, the workflow runs from DI conform through primary balancing, secondary keying, and look development against director and DP intent. It ends in final theatrical and streaming deliverables on schedules built around iQIYI, Tencent Video, Youku, and Mango TV release windows. Remote grading sessions over Streambox, Sohonet ClearView, or Resolve's joint work tools are standard practice. The CST timezone overlaps with European mornings and Asia-Pacific afternoons, which makes round-the-clock turnover practical on tight delivery schedules.

What does a colorist do?
A colorist owns the final grading of a film or video project. They adjust color, contrast, saturation, and luminance to set the visual mood and keep each shot consistent. In China, colorists work across a wide range of shoots. These span blockbuster features and high-volume episodic content for streaming sites.
What skills should a colorist have?
A colorist needs a sharp eye for color and detail, deep knowledge of color science, and command of pro grading tools like DaVinci Resolve. Chinese colorists more and more work with AI-helped workflows and cloud-based pipelines alongside classic grading methods.
What types of productions need a colorist?
Every production that goes through post-prod gains from pro grading. Feature films, episodic television, commercials, documentaries, and music videos all need a colorist. China's market — the world's second-largest — supports huge volumes of both theatrical and streaming content that needs pro grading.
